k_nwmn 0 Posted March 1, 2015 Share Posted March 1, 2015 Hey guys, this may be an obvious question and rest assured that I did as much forum searching as possible before posting but to no avail. I downloaded a template for a B60 Duke, copied all the text into a .txt file, and saved it into PFPX Data/AircraftTypes/ but I am so far unable to find it on the aircraft drop down list. srcooke 421 Posted March 2, 2015 Share Posted March 2, 2015 With the file available from the Aerosoft downloads page and placed in \Public\Documents\PFPX Data\AircraftTypes the model becomes available when selecting New Aircraft from the aircraft manager tab: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
k_nwmn 0 Posted March 2, 2015 Author Share Posted March 2, 2015 There it is! I was putting the file into the PFPX install folder instead of the My Documents/ folder. That solved it, thank you Stephen.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
